Robin Lynn Heiken is a financial advisor based in Belleville, Illinois, operating through Raymond James & Associates, Inc. With 32 years in the financial services industry, Heiken brings substantial experience to client relationships. The business is registered with FINRA under CRD number 1633226, indicating oversight by the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ority. Heiken works within the regulatory framework that governs investment advisors and securities professionals.
Robin Lynn Heiken holds a FINRA CRD registration, which means the advisor is registered with the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ority. This registration indicates that Heiken meets FINRA's qualification standards and operates under its regulatory oversight. FINRA registration signals that the advisor is authorized to conduct securities business and is subject to ongoing compliance requirements, background checks, and continuing education mandates. This regulatory framework is designed to protect investors by ensuring advisors maintain professional standards and adhere to industry rules.
